Name of the Charge. Added to the Bill line item description for Charge.
The unique short code of the Charge.
The ID of the Account the Charge was created for.
The date when the Charge will be added to a Bill.
The Charge amount. If amount has been defined, then units and unitPrice cannot be used.
Number of units of the Charge. Provided together with unitPrice. If units and unitPrice are provided, amount cannot be used.
Unit Price for the Charge. Provided together with units:

The description added to the Bill line item for the Charge.
The entity type the Charge has been created for.
AD_HOC, BALANCE The ID of the Charge linked entity. For example, the ID of an Account Balance if a Balance Charge.
The ID of the Bill created for this Charge.
The Accounting Product ID assigned to the Charge.
The service period start date (in ISO-8601 format) for the Charge .
The service period end date (in ISO-8601 format) for the Charge.
NOTE: End date is exclusive.
Information about the Charge for accounting purposes, such as the reason it was created. This information will not be added to the created Bill line item for the Charge.
The ID of a Contract on the Account that the Charge has been added to.
The line item type used for billing a Charge.
